Product Information

Fmoc-N-methyl-O-methyl-L-tyrosine is a versatile amino acid derivative widely utilized in peptide synthesis and drug development. This compound features a fluorenylmethoxycarbonyl (Fmoc) protective group, which is essential for the selective protection of amines during the synthesis of peptides. Its unique structure, incorporating both N-methyl and O-methyl modifications, enhances its stability and solubility, making it an ideal choice for researchers seeking to optimize their synthetic pathways.

In practical applications, Fmoc-N-methyl-O-methyl-L-tyrosine is particularly valuable in the development of bioactive peptides and pharmaceuticals. Its properties allow for efficient coupling reactions, facilitating the construction of complex peptide sequences with improved yield and purity. Additionally, this compound is instrumental in the study of receptor interactions and the design of therapeutic agents, showcasing its relevance in both academic research and the pharmaceutical industry. Synonyms
Fmoc-N-Me-L-Tyr(Me)-OH
CAS Number
1260595-45-6
Purity
≥ 99% (HPLC)
Molecular Formula
C26H25NO5
Molecular Weight
431.49
MDL Number
MFCD04974263
PubChem ID
22327138
Appearance
Pale white solid
Conditions
Store at 0-8 °C

Applications

Fmoc-N-methyl-O-methyl-L-tyrosine is widely utilized in research focused on:

  • Peptide Synthesis: This compound is a key building block in the synthesis of peptides, allowing researchers to create complex proteins for various studies, including drug development and biological research.
  • Drug Development: Its unique structure enhances the solubility and stability of peptide drugs, making it a valuable component in the pharmaceutical industry for creating more effective medications.
  • Bioconjugation: The chemical is used in bioconjugation processes, where it helps attach biomolecules to surfaces or other molecules, facilitating the development of targeted therapies and diagnostics.
  • Research in Neuroscience: It plays a role in studying neurotransmitter systems, particularly in the development of compounds that can modulate receptor activity, which is crucial for understanding brain function and disorders.
  • Protein Engineering: Researchers utilize this compound to modify proteins, improving their functionality and stability, which is essential in fields like biotechnology and synthetic biology.
